  • A Campus Life Large Group Leader will support weekly large group clubs at Akron-Westfield, helping with tasks such as setup, registration, food distribution, games, speaking, and small group time. Volunteers should have a passion for reaching youth with Christ-centered programming, be able to commit time weekly, and enjoy working with young people in a group setting. The role requires 2-4 hours per week, with flexible scheduling.

  • A Campus Life Small Group Leader will lead weekly small groups through YFC curriculum focused on Biblical topics, the Gospel, or relevant life issues. Volunteers should have a passion for mentoring youth in the Akron-Westfield community, commit to weekly sessions, and feel comfortable facilitating structured group discussions. Responsibilities include fostering relationships, preparing lessons and materials, and praying for students. The role requires 2-4 flexible hours per week.
